+export default {
+  contentDependencies: ['generatePageSidebarBox'],
+  extraDependencies: ['html'],
+
+  relations: (relation) => ({
+    box:
+      relation('generatePageSidebarBox'),
+  }),
+
+  slots: {
+    // Content is a flat HTML array. It'll all be placed into one sidebar box
+    // if specified.
+    content: {
+      type: 'html',
+      mutable: false,
+    },
+
+    // Attributes to apply to the whole sidebar. If specifying multiple
+    // sections, this be added to the containing sidebar-column, arr - specify
+    // attributes on each section if that's more suitable.
+    attributes: {
+      type: 'attributes',
+      mutable: false,
+    },
+
+    // Chunks of content to be split into separate boxes in the sidebar.
+    boxes: {
+      type: 'html',
+      mutable: false,
+    },
+
+    // Sticky mode controls which sidebar sections, if any, follow the
+    // scroll position, "sticking" to the top of the browser viewport.
+    //
+    // 'last' - last or only sidebar box is sticky
+    // 'column' - entire column, incl. multiple boxes from top, is sticky
+    // 'static' - sidebar not sticky at all, stays at top of page
+    //
+    // Note: This doesn't affect the content of any sidebar section, only
+    // the whole section's containing box (or the sidebar column as a whole).
+    stickyMode: {
+      validate: v => v.is('last', 'column', 'static'),
+      default: 'static',
+    },
+
+    // Collapsing sidebars disappear when the viewport is sufficiently
+    // thin. (This is the default.) Override as false to make the sidebar
+    // stay visible in thinner viewports, where the page layout will be
+    // reflowed so the sidebar is as wide as the screen and appears below
+    // nav, above the main content.
+    collapse: {
+      type: 'boolean',
+      default: true,
+    },
+
+    // Wide sidebars generally take up more horizontal space in the normal
+    // page layout, and should be used if the content of the sidebar has
+    // a greater than typical focus compared to main content.
+    wide: {
+      type: 'boolean',
+      default: false,
+    },
+  },
+
+  generate(relations, slots, {html}) {
+    const attributes =
+      html.attributes({class: [
+        'sidebar-column',
+        'sidebar-multiple',
+      ]});
+
+    attributes.add(slots.attributes);
+
+    if (slots.class) {
+      attributes.add('class', slots.class);
+    }
+
+    if (slots.wide) {
+      attributes.add('class', 'wide');
+    }
+
+    if (!slots.collapse) {
+      attributes.add('class', 'no-hide');
+    }
+
+    if (slots.stickyMode !== 'static') {
+      attributes.add('class', `sticky-${slots.stickyMode}`);
+    }
+
+    const boxes =
+      (!html.isBlank(slots.boxes)
+        ? slots.boxes
+     : !html.isBlank(slots.content)
+        ? relations.box.slot('content', slots.content)
+        : html.blank());
+
+    if (html.isBlank(boxes)) {
+      return html.blank();
+    } else {
+      return html.tag('div', attributes, boxes);
+    }
+  },
+};
